search

軟體測試的流程

軟體測試流程五個階段分別是什麼

  軟體測試流程五個階段分別:需求分析階段、軟體設計和編碼階段、整合階段。系統階段、驗收測試階段。

  軟體測試(英語:SoftwareTesting),描述一種用來促進鑑定軟體的正確性、完整性、安全性和質量的過程。換句話說,軟體測試是一種實際輸出與預期輸出之間的稽核或者比較過程。軟體測試的經典定義是:在規定的條件下對程式進行操作,以發現程式錯誤,衡量軟體質量,並對其是否能滿足設計要求進行評估的過程。

軟體測試的流程

  一般測試流程:

  需求分析階段:對業務的學習,分析需求點進行分析;測試計劃階段:測試組長就要根據SOW開始編寫《測試計劃》,其中包括人員,軟體硬體資源,測試點,整合順序,進度安排和風險識別等內容;測試設計階段:測試方案由對需求很熟的高資深的測試工程師設計,測試方案要求根據《SRS》上的每個需求點設計出包括需求點簡介,測試思路和詳細測試方法三部分的方案。《測試方案》編寫完成後需要進行評審;測試方案階段:主要是對測試用例和規程的設計。測試用例是根據《測試方案》來編寫的,透過《測試方案》階段,測試人員

軟體功能測試流程

  功能測試是看軟體有沒有達到預期設計的要求。或者說有沒有達到客戶的要求。

  首先向開發部或者專案經理要一份需求文件,然後對照軟體把一個個的功能點列出來。然後寫明測試用例。

  知道了預期結果後在實際操作中和預期結果不同的即軟體的漏洞。


手機軟體測試的基本流程

  手機軟體測試的基本流程:   1、測試需求分析;   2、測試計劃或者測試用例書寫;   3、測試環境搭建,測試資料準備以及測試執行;   4、測試反饋,指測試過程中發現異常,進行缺陷分析定位,然後和相關的開發人員進行對應,最後促使問題得到解決的過程;   5、測試專案結束後的總結分析;   6、迴歸測試 ...

軟體測試的工作流程是什麼

  工作流程如下:   1、需求分析:首先需要要學習並瞭解軟體的業務,分析需求點;   2、測試計劃:編寫整個測試計劃,在這個過程中需要參考需求規格說明書,這個階段一般情況下是測試主管編寫。包括了測試人員,測試時間,測試工具,測試方法等;   3、測試用例設計:是測試工作中的最核心的模組,在執行任何測試之前, ...

軟體測試需要知道哪些知識

  做軟體測試首先要把什麼技能學掌握了從開始的功能測試該從哪個方向提升自己   方法/步驟1會一門程式語言,會到什麼程度,能寫自動化指令碼;但是能不能做好測試不僅僅是會程式設計而已。   2會SQL,除非那種報表型別的測試,會普通增刪改查,知道4種join的區別就可以了(如果你想成為DBA,那麼建議你還是深入 ...

軟體開發流程分析,分享給大家

  專案規劃:專案開發計劃,由於偉創軟體是定製開發,所以只需規劃好人員、技術分配,後期調研計劃,基礎開發等方面   需求分析:這一點不管是對企業還是開發公司來說都很重要,若是前期需求過於簡單,後續如果需要調整會相當困難,對系統的擴充套件性要求比較高   方案確定:這時候調研已經完成,開始分配人員計劃,進入軟體 ...

軟體測試的就業前景怎樣

  軟體測試就業門檻低,人才需求量大。   1、就業競爭小。IT人才是企業需求量最大的人群,作為軟體開發流程中的重要一環,軟體測試崗位漸漸"浮出水面",並憑藉其龐大的人才需求和廣闊的職場發展前景日漸成為IT職場就業的大熱門。   2、職業發展方向多元化。由於工作的特殊性,測試人員不但需要對軟體 ...

軟體測試的職業發展

  軟體測試工程師有4個發展方向:   1、資深軟體測試工程師。達到這個水平比需要了解C語言、JAVA語言、資料庫、資料結構、軟體工程等;   2、測試部門管理者。小的如組長,大的如測試經理,這需善於交流溝通,善於處理人際關係;   3、測試書籍編寫者。當在這一行幹了幾年,積攢了足夠的經驗,可以把經驗和具體做 ...

軟體測試需要學什麼

  1、第一步,測試基礎。測試計劃編寫、設計測試用例、編寫測試報告、編寫BUG報告單、跟蹤BUG修復情況、還需要良好的溝通能力、以及各種測試階段所使用的測試方法、單元測試、功能測試、整合測試、系統測試等。   2、第二步:學習指令碼語言。python語言,當然python 是一門相對簡單的計算機語言,考慮長遠 ...